Singapore - 80pct of luxury apartment buyers are non-Singaporeans

CRIENGLISH.com, 12 Sep 2011
Foreigners are buying about 60 percent of the luxury apartments with a price tag of more than 5 million Singapore dollars (4.1 million U.S. dollars) in the first half of the year, local daily Straits Times reported on Monday.
Foreigners, including permanent residents, bought 162 non- landed units worth above 5 million Singapore dollars in the six months, building on a trend of increasing foreign buyer interest since the heady days of 2007, it said.
